Transaction 4578049f562d538ec146825cc00a2dcbef6c3cee7c95a5a9084b75be9d10e12b

1 Input
2 Outputs
  • 4578049f562d538ec146825cc00a2dcbef6c3cee7c95a5a9084b75be9d10e12b:0
  • value  718326484
    address  126mojLNhLjY9kQDftjzqFpoTSDjG8dC2D
  • 4578049f562d538ec146825cc00a2dcbef6c3cee7c95a5a9084b75be9d10e12b:1
  • value  6583082967
    address  13fmVLeXDi6J1DBWEjGSjKa4vp8gphnFB8